Deck Skirting Installation in Kansas City, KS
Deck skirting installation involves adding a decorative and protective enclosure around the base of a deck. This service is commonly requested for projects where homeowners want to improve the appearance of their outdoor space, hide the area beneath the deck, or prevent debris, animals, and pests from entering the space underneath. Materials used for deck skirting can include lattice, vinyl, wood panels, or composite options, allowing for customization based on style preferences and maintenance needs.
Property owners typically want to understand the different types of skirting available, the durability of various materials, and how the installation process may impact their existing deck. It’s also important to consider the overall design, ventilation, and access to the space underneath the deck, especially if future maintenance or storage is planned. Clarifying these details can help ensure the skirting complements the deck’s appearance and meets functional needs.

Common Deck Skirting Installation Jobs
Deck skirting installation helps create a finished look around the base of a deck.
Vented skirting allows airflow to prevent moisture buildup beneath the deck.
Lattice skirting provides a decorative barrier that also offers ventilation.
Wood skirting enhances the natural appearance of outdoor deck areas.
Vinyl or composite skirting offers low-maintenance options for durability and style.

Deck Skirting Installation Questions
What is deck skirting installation? It involves adding a decorative and protective covering around the base of a deck to enhance appearance and prevent debris buildup.
What materials are used for deck skirting? Common options include lattice panels, vinyl, wood, or composite materials, chosen to match the deck’s style and durability needs.
Why should property owners consider deck skirting? It improves the deck’s appearance, hides the foundation, and helps keep out pests and debris from underneath the deck.
